Preparation method of nano porous metal oxide/carbon lithium ion battery cathode material

The invention provides a preparation method of a nano porous metal oxide/carbon lithium ion battery cathode material. The preparation method comprises the following steps: firstly, weighting ferric salt or manganese salt and carboxylate organic ligands, and putting into a high-pressure reaction kettle; and after a polar solvent is added and dissolved, carrying out a hydrothermal reaction for 10-72h at 100-180 DEG C to generate a transition metal coordination polymer precursor; and after the transition metal coordination polymer precursor is washed and dried, decomposing the precursor for 0.5-6h at a temperature of 300-600 DEG C in an inert atmosphere in a tube furnace, thus obtaining a nano porous metal oxide/carbon lithium ion battery cathode material containing iron oxides or manganese oxides. According to the preparation method, since the transition metal coordination polymer precursor which is structurally designable and controllable is used as a template-type precursor, a nano porous metal oxide/carbon lithium ion battery cathode material is obtained by using an in-situ thermal decomposition method. The method is simple in process, and the obtained products have the advantages of high electrical conductivity, high specific capacity, good cycle stability, excellent high-ratio discharge performance and high energy density.

Method of preparing fluorine-containing lead dioxide electrode on titanium basal body

The present invention relates to a process for preparing fluorine containing lead dioxide electrode at titanium substrate. The plating structural of said fluorine containing lead dioxide electrode is as follows: from the titanium substrate surface and from inner to outer, in sequences, there are plated the tin-stibium oxidate bottom layer, alpha-PbO2 layer and fluorine contain containing beta- PbO2 layer. Said method comprises the steps of surface roughening treatment of titanium substrate, then plating the tin-stibium oxidate bottom layer through a thermal decomposition method, and then obtaining titanium substrate fluorine containing beta- PbO2 electrode through alkaline electric plating alpha-PbO2 and acidic composite electric plating beta- PbO2.The fluorine containing lead dioxide electrode prepared through the process and method in accordance with the present invention possesses strong bonding force between the plating layer and the substrate, small limiting surface electric resistance and inner stress, low price amd long service lifetime of electrode, can be applied widely in electrolytic industry fields of acidic system.

Preparation method for tantalum-contained interlayer metallic oxide electrode

The invention belongs to the electrochemical technical field, and relates to a preparation method for a tantalum-contained interlayer metallic oxide electrode. The electrode is suitable for occasions including steel plate high-speed electroplating, seawater electrolysis marine life pollution and damage prevention devices, sodium hypochlorite electrolysis production devices, sewage treatment, cathode protection and the like in the electrochemistry industrial field. The main process comprises three steps, namely substrate pretreatment, tantalum-contained interlayer preparation and oxide coatingpreparation: firstly, a tantalum-contained interlayer is prepared on a titanium substrate by adopting a thermal decomposition method, and then a mixed metallic oxide electro-catalysis coating is prepared on the tantalum-contained interlayer; the mass percent purity of the metallic titanium substrate is larger than 99%; and the process is simple and convenient to carry out, the metallic oxide electrode with larger size or more complicated structure can be prepared, and the tantalum-contained interlayer can better protect the titanium substrate, delay the titanium substrate inactivation, improve the stability of the oxide electrode and prolong the service life.

Nano loaded titanium-based electric catalytic film and preparation method thereof

The invention discloses a nano loaded titanium-based electric catalytic film comprising a conductive microporous separating titanium film matrix and a catalytic coating. Furthermore, the invention also discloses a preparation method of the nano loaded titanium-based electric catalytic film, which comprises the following steps of: (1) preprocessing the titanium film matrix by sand blasting, alkali washing, and acid etching: soaking the matrix after sand blasting in an NaOH solution for 0.5 to 2h, then processing for 1 to 2h in an oxalic acid solution with the mass percent concentration of 10 percent after washing to a neutral state, washing with water and drying at 100 to 120 DEG C; and (2) preparing and loading a catalytic coating: preparing the catalytic coating by adopting a sol-gel method, a thermal decomposition method, an electrodeposition method or a chemical vapor deposition method and loading at the surface of the titanium film matrix and in a hole. Furthermore, the invention also discloses a film reactor comprising the nano loaded titanium-based electric catalytic film. According to the nano loaded titanium-based electric catalytic film, the defects on material strength, range limitation of working voltage, catalytic oxidation efficacy and the like in the prior art are solved.

Rare earth up-conversion fluorescent material doped with luminescent center in different regions and preparation method thereof

The invention discloses a luminescent centre regionally doped rare earth upconversion luminescent material and a preparation method thereof, which relates to the technical field of structural design and preparation of luminescent materials. For solving the problems of small doping amount in the luminescent center and low luminescent efficiency of the rare earth upconversion luminescent material, the conventional materials of the same kind take NaYF4 as a matrix, are doped with rare earth sensitized ions and rare earth luminescent ions and has a core/shell structure and nanocrystalline micro structure, wherein a luminescent shell layer is coated outside the core/shell structure, and a sensitized layer is the outmost layer. The preparation method of the rare earth upconversion luminescent material comprises: after a trifluoroacetate thermal decomposition method is implemented, adding a luminescent shell layer precursor into solution of nanoparticle colloid with the luminescent core/shell structure, heating, and reacting to form the luminescent shell layer; cooling the product obtained by the previous step, adding a sensitized shell precursor layer, heating, reacting and obtaining a sensitized shell layer on the outside of the luminescent shell layer; and thus, obtaining the luminescent centre regionally doped rare earth upconversion luminescent material.

Method for surface pre-treatment of titanium electrode substrate

The invention belongs to the field of metal material and relates to a method for surface treatment of a titanium electrode substrate. The service life and the electrocatalysis performance of the titanium electrode are greatly increased by the abrasive blasting pretreatment to the substrate. The abrasive blasting treatment is carried out on the titanium substrate; the nozzle pressure of an abrasive blasting machine is 0.3-0.5MPa; the Al2O3 grinding medium of 70-90 meshes is adopted; the blasting angle is 45-90 degrees; the distance from the nozzle to a workpiece is 1-2cm; the coarsening time is 15-30s; the titanium substrate is then pickled for pickling treatment in a 10wt.% of oxalic acid solution for 1.5-2.5 hours at the temperature of 90-95 DEG C; a Ti/IrO2.Ta2O5 oxide coating electrode is prepared on the obtained substrate by a thermal decomposition method, wherein the Ir is chloro-iridic acid, Ta is tantalum pentachloride and the molar ratio of Ir to Ta is 7:3; a coating solution is uniformly coated on the pre-treated titanium substrate by a soft hair brush; the titanium substrate is dried for 10min at the temperature of 120 DEG C, is subsequently arranged in a box-type resistance furnace and sintered for 10min at the temperature of 450 DEG C; the above operations of coating, drying and sintering are repeatedly carried out by 5-20 times; and the final sintering is carried out for 1h at the temperature of 450 DEG C. The method provides optimum pretreatment parameters, greatly prolongs the service life of the titanium electrode, effectively improves the electrocatalytic activity and greatly reduces the running and repairing cost for the electrode.

Electrode material with intermediate Ti4O7 coating

The invention discloses an electrode material with an intermediate Ti4O7 coating and belongs to the technical fields of hydrometallurgy and electrochemistry metallurgy. Titanium, aluminum and a titanium alloy or an aluminum alloy are taken as the inner core structure of an electrode, the surface of the electrode is coated with Ti4O7 which has excellent chemical performance such as low electrical resistivity, high activity, good electrochemical corrosion resistance and the like, so that the electricity conduction performance of the electrode is improved and an inner core material is protected; then a high-activity low-price metal oxide coating is prepared with an electroplating method or a high-activity rare metal oxide coating is prepared with a thermal decomposition method on the surface of the electrode. Current distribution of the electrode material is uniform, the purity of an electro-deposition product is high, the polarization potential of the composite electrode of the intermediate Ti4O7 coating is reduced by 70-188 mV than that of a traditional ti-based electrode, the current density is increased by 40-230 mA, the catalytic activity of the electrode is improved, the electrode potential is reduced in the practical use process, and energy conservation and consumption reduction are realized.

Method for preparing a mixture of powdered metal oxides from nitrates thereof in the nuclear industry

Date Jun. 19, 1997A thermal decomposition method useful in the nuclear industry for preparing a powdered mixture of metal oxides having suitable reactivity from nitrates thereof in the form of an aqueous solution or a mixture of solids. According to the method, the solution or the mixture of solids is thermomechanically contacted with a gaseous fluid in the contact area of a reaction chamber, said gaseous fluid being fed into the reaction chamber at the same time as the solution or mixture at a temperature no lower than the decomposition temperature of the nitrates, and having a mechanical energy high enough to generate a fine spray of the solution or a fine dispersion of the solid mixture, and instantly decompose the nitrates. The resulting oxide mixtures may be used to prepare nuclear fuels.

Continuous thermal decomposition method and apparatus for sludge

The invention relates to a continuous thermal decomposition method and apparatus for sludge. The method comprises the following steps: drying and carbonization: a step of drying and carbonizing to-be-treated sludge at negative pressure; heat exchange and recovery: a step of subjecting high-temperature water vapor produced in the drying process of the sludge to heat exchange and condensation, recovering heat, applying the recovered heat to drying, adsorbing and filtering condensed water with carbon produced by carbonization and then recovering the treated condensed water for cyclic utilization; and treatment of combustion tail gas: a step of cooling flue gas produced by carbonization with the outer wall of a drying system, washing the flue gas with the condensed water, discharging the washed flue gas and subjecting waste water produced in washing to adsorption and impurity removal by carbon produced by carbonization of the sludge so as to form filtered water for cyclic utilization. The continuous thermal decomposition method for the sludge makes full use of heat and products produced in drying and carbonization of the sludge, recovers the heat and cyclically applies the recovered heat to drying and carbonization of the sludge, so a self-sufficient heat energy supply system is established, and no extra energy is consumed; thus, the method is energy-saving and environment-friendly.

Nano mesoporous microspherical Bi5O7I photocatalyst and hydrothermal-thermal decomposition preparation method thereof

The invention relates to a nano mesoporous microspherical Bi5O7I photocatalyst and a hydrothermal-thermal decomposition preparation method thereof. The Bi5O7I photocatalyst is of a nano mesoporous microspherical shape; the average particle size of microspheres is 1 to 5 microns, and the average aperture of mesoporous on the surface of the microspheres is 7 to 9 nm. The method comprises the following steps: respectively dissolving bismuth salt and iodine salt into quantitative ethylene glycol, performing ultrasonic oscillation treatment, slowly adding iodine salt solution into bismuth salt solution after complete dissolving, performing magnetic stirring to obtain a precursor BiOI, performing hydrothermal reaction on the precursor to prepare BiOI powder, heating the powder body in a tubular furnace under high temperature for decomposition, and preserving the temperature for 2 h to prepare Bi5O7I powder. The Bi5O7I powder prepared by the hydrothermal-thermal decomposition method has the characteristics of uniform shape, high stability and good photocatalysis performance, integrates the advantages of the hydrothermal method and the thermal decomposition method, and is short in reaction time, simple in technological process, lower in raw material cost and suitable for industrial popularization and application.
